-
java框架如何赋能人工智能发展?
java 框架通过以下方式赋能 ai:数据管理和处理:spark、hadoop 和 tensorflow data 用于处理和存储 ai 数据。机器学习和深度学习:tensorflow、scikit-learn 和 opencv 用于构建和训练机器学习模型。模型部署和服务:springboot、kubernetes 和 docker 用于部署和管理 ai 模型。 Java 框架如何赋能人工智能 (AI) AI 正在快速发展,Java 框架在其中发挥着至关重要的作用。这些框架...
作者:wufei123 日期:2024.06.03 分类:JAVA 5 -
java框架安全架构设计如何防范跨站脚本攻击?
Java 框架安全架构设计:防范跨站脚本 (XSS) 攻击 什么是跨站脚本 (XSS) 攻击? XSS 攻击是一种常见的网络安全威胁,它允许攻击者在受害者的浏览器中执行恶意脚本。这可能导致敏感信息的窃取、会话劫持或网站破坏等严重后果。 Java 框架中的 XSS 防范措施 1. 输入验证和过滤: 验证用户输入,防止他们注入恶意脚本。常见的过滤方法包括 HTML 实体编码、正则表达式验证和白名单输入。String safeInput = HttpServletRequest....
作者:wufei123 日期:2024.06.03 分类:JAVA 8 -
java框架在人工智能超大规模应用中的挑战是什么?
在人工智能超大规模应用中,java 框架面临着并发性、可扩展性、内存管理、资源管理和数据 i/o 等挑战。通过解决这些挑战,如使用分布式架构、有效的内存管理机制、资源管理接口和高速数据 i/o 支持,开发人员可以构建可扩展、可靠且高效的 ai 解决方案。 Java 框架在人工智能超大规模应用中的挑战 引言 人工智能 (AI) 超大规模应用已成为当今技术领域的热点话题。借助 Java 框架,开发人员可以构建复杂且可扩展的 AI 解决方案,为各种行业带来转型。然而,在超大规模应...
作者:wufei123 日期:2024.06.03 分类:JAVA 33 -
java框架安全架构设计如何抵御 SQL 注入攻击?
sql注入是通过用户输入操纵sql查询的攻击。java框架提供防御措施:输入验证和清理:删除恶意字符(如单引号)参数化查询:使用占位符传递用户输入,防止其成为查询的一部分orm框架:抽象数据库交互,降低sql注入漏洞风险 用 Java 框架架构抵御 SQL 注入攻击 SQL 注入攻击是一个常见的网络安全威胁,它利用了用户输入来操纵应用程序的 SQL 查询。为了抵御这种攻击,Java 框架提供了一些安全措施,例如: 1. 输入验证和清理 在接受用户输入时,框架会对输入进行验证...
作者:wufei123 日期:2024.06.03 分类:JAVA 10 -
java框架安全架构设计如何提高开发效率?
java 框架安全架构设计通过遵循安全原则(如输入验证、输出编码、身份验证和授权)来提升开发效率。 实战案例包括:使用 spring security 实现身份验证和授权,使用 owasp esapi 验证输入。通过应用这些原则和案例,开发人员可以构建安全的 java 应用程序,同时提高效率。 Java 框架安全架构设计:提升开发效率的实用指南 引言 在当今数字时代,构建安全的应用程序至关重要。Java 框架提供了健壮的基础,可以实现广泛的安全功能。通过遵循最佳实践并应用经...
作者:wufei123 日期:2024.06.03 分类:JAVA 5 -
java框架中网关中间件的架构和实施
网关中间件在 java 框架中的架构和实现架构:客户端:与网关交互api 网关:路由请求认证/授权模块:验证权限速率限制器:防止过度使用负载均衡器:分配请求实施:spring cloud gateway:基于 spring boot 的反应式网关zuul:spring boot 兼容网关kong:独立且可扩展的 api 网关 Java 框架中的网关中间件架构与实现 简介 网关中间件在 Java 框架中扮演着至关重要的角色。它作为应用程序和外部世界的单一入口点,提供诸如身份验...
作者:wufei123 日期:2024.06.03 分类:JAVA 5 -
java框架安全架构设计应如何与业务需求相平衡?
通过平衡安全需求和业务需求,java 框架设计可实现安全:识别关键业务需求,优先考虑相关安全要求。制定弹性安全策略,分层应对威胁,定期调整。考虑架构灵活性,支持业务演变,抽象安全功能。优先考虑效率和可用性,优化安全措施,提高可见性。 Java 框架安全架构设计与业务需求的平衡 在设计 Java 框架的安全架构时,平衡安全需求和业务需求至关重要。以下是如何实现此平衡: 1. 识别关键业务需求 确定应用程序的核心功能和数据处理流程。 分析业务流程中的潜在安全风险。 优先考虑与...
作者:wufei123 日期:2024.06.03 分类:JAVA 6 -
java框架安全架构设计如何应对 DDoS 攻击?
摘要:java 框架的安全架构可以通过以下策略抵御 ddos 攻击:流量过滤和清洗阈值检测和速率限制冗余和弹性ip 黑名单和白名单内容分发网络 (cdn)具体案例中,spring boot 网站实施了防火墙、请求过滤、速率限制和 cdn,以有效抵御 ddos 攻击。 Java 框架安全架构:应对 DDoS 攻击的全面指南 简介 分布式拒绝服务(DDoS)攻击是一种威胁网站和在线服务的网络攻击,通过用虚假流量压垮目标系统的资源,使其无法访问。在本文中,我们将探讨 Java 框...
作者:wufei123 日期:2024.06.03 分类:JAVA 4 -
java框架在人工智能应用中的优势有哪些?
java 框架因其健壮性、可扩展性和易用性而成为人工智能应用开发的理想选择,它提供自动化和效率,集成和互操作性,定制灵活性,以及性能和可扩展性。实战案例包括 apache opennlp(nlp)、deepjavalibrary(图像识别)和 weka(机器学习)。java 框架为人工智能应用提供了强大的基础,使其成为 ai 开发人员的首选语言。 Java 框架在人工智能应用中的优势 Java 框架以其健壮性、可扩展性和易用性而闻名,使其成为人工智能(AI)应用开发的首选。...
作者:wufei123 日期:2024.06.03 分类:JAVA 9 -
Java框架中的数据访问层设计与领域驱动设计的融合
将 java 框架中的数据访问层 (dal) 与领域驱动设计 (ddd) 融合可以创造一个健壮且可扩展的数据访问层。融合过程涉及:定义领域模型,表示业务领域中的实体;创建 dao 存储库,封装特定聚合的数据访问操作;使用查询方法,使用 java 8 lambda 或方法引用来指定查询条件;处理事务,使用 @transactional 注释标记方法,以指示它们应该在一个事务中执行。 Java 框架中的数据访问层设计与领域驱动设计融合 在 Java 框架中,数据访问层 (DAL...
作者:wufei123 日期:2024.06.03 分类:JAVA 5